Hyungi Ahn
473e7e2e6d
feat(search): Phase 0.4 debug 응답 옵션 + timing 로그
?debug=true로 호출 시 단계별 candidates + timing을 응답에 포함.
디버그 옵션과 별개로 모든 검색에 timing 라인을 구조화 로그로 출력
(사용자 feedback: 운영 관찰엔 debug 응답만으론 부족).
신규 응답 필드 (debug=true 시):
- timing_ms: text_ms / vector_ms / merge_ms / total_ms
- text_candidates / vector_candidates / fused_candidates (top 20)
- confidence (telemetry와 동일 휴리스틱)
- notes (예: vector 검색 실패 시 fallback 표시)
- query_analysis / reranker_scores: Phase 1/2용 placeholder
기본 응답(debug=false)은 변화 없음 (results, total, query, mode).
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
2026-04-07 08:41:33 +09:00
..
2026-04-02 10:20:15 +09:00
2026-04-03 06:53:59 +09:00
2026-04-06 07:15:13 +09:00
2026-04-06 15:15:15 +09:00
2026-04-06 15:27:01 +09:00
2026-04-07 08:41:33 +09:00
2026-04-02 15:33:31 +09:00